pthatcher94a2f212017-02-08 14:42:22 -080027// RFC 5389 says SHOULD be 500ms.
28// For years, this was 100ms, but for networks that
29// experience moments of high RTT (such as 2G networks), this doesn't
30// work well.
31const int STUN_INITIAL_RTO = 250; // milliseconds
32
33// The timeout doubles each retransmission, up to this many times
34// RFC 5389 says SHOULD retransmit 7 times.
35// This has been 8 for years (not sure why).
Jonas Olssona4d87372019-07-05 19:08:33 +020036const int STUN_MAX_RETRANSMISSIONS = 8; // Total sends: 9
Bjorn Terelius0d289722019-02-01 15:22:20 +010037const int STUN_MAX_RETRANSMISSIONS_RFC_5389 = 6; // Total sends: 7
pthatcher94a2f212017-02-08 14:42:22 -080038
39// We also cap the doubling, even though the standard doesn't say to.
40// This has been 1.6 seconds for years, but for networks that
41// experience moments of high RTT (such as 2G networks), this doesn't
42// work well.
43const int STUN_MAX_RTO = 8000; // milliseconds, or 5 doublings
